前言

fiddler作为一个中间商协议代理,众所周知,有请求就会有响应,那没有响应呢?那就是哪个环节出现问题了。通过代理就可以查看到所有请求信息、与响应信息。举个例子,以前上学时有没有写过情书?或者给别人传过情书?我倒是给妹子写过,也有收到过!

例子:

我曾经写了一封情书,内容是xxx,但是自己不敢直接给到她,这时我想到的是委托她身边的朋友再给到我喜欢的妹子,于是我便让她这位身边的朋友将情书给到妹子手上。此过程呢,我就是一个请求,她身边的朋友就是代理,但是代理是不是就可以知道里面的内容,甚至曝光我的情书内容了呢?甚至更改我的情书内容,不给到妹子手上?显然是的。 如果妹子收到了,没鸟我、没回我,是不是我内容不够丰富姿势不对?还是不喜欢我?所以这个时候就要考虑到了知己知彼百战百胜,了解妹子想要什么喜欢什么,这是不是对应我们的接口文档了呢?至于妹子是不是我的你们说了算,一下来学习吧!

下载与安装

1.下载后直接运行,下一步、下一步、下一步安装完成后,到安装目录下运行 Fiddler.exe 就行了(小技巧:可创建一个快捷方式到桌面哦)

 2.界面简介...这个就不介绍了,直接开始实战。

①首先设置可抓htpps的接口,打开界面:Tools>Options>https,如下图勾选上,在点击ok,重启软件即可。

本人使用的是Chome,可以直接开启抓包了,如果抓不到就设置下fiddler证书代理,一般都可以的,这里就不细说了。

 3.一起来抓个web浏览器的包吧

开着fiddler,本人在Chome直接输入 https://www.baidu.com/,那么fiddler中就看到了请求与响应信息。

这里要说下,是需要点击某个接口才能看到请求与响应信息,我们可以看到,请求方式:get  状态码:200  协议是:https  host(域名):www.baidu.com  url:/

同同我们也可以看到右侧中的请求信息与响应信息。一般查看 Raw 即可,当然也有的小伙伴查看 JSON等等的。

看到了这里不妨去实操下吧!告诉你一些快捷键:F12 开启/关闭抓包,F6-F12是快捷键哦,快点看看是什么作用呢?知道后请你告诉我!!!

如果想知道手机端如何抓包,那么请看下一篇吧~欢迎来QQ交流群:482713805

最新文章

  1. Eclipse引入外部Jar在发布时没有自动带入,导致出现ClassNoFound错误
  2. 第 11 章 进度条媒体对象和 Well 组件
  3. 玉伯的一道课后题题解(关于 IEEE 754 双精度浮点型精度损失)
  4. 【WP8.1】富文本
  5. Bean的生命周期
  6. leetcode 114 Flatten Binary Tree to Linked List ----- java
  7. “System.Exception: System.Data.OracleClient 需要 Oracle 客户端软件 8.1.7 或更高版本” 的解决方案
  8. winform拖动无边框窗体
  9. if语句求三个数中最大的
  10. 使用CountDownLatch和CyclicBarrier处理并发线程
  11. python 基础学习4-with语句
  12. 24. pt-slave-find
  13. 又见C++
  14. 13 Tensorflow API主要功能
  15. emwin之求解窗口坐标及大小的一种方法
  16. C#设计模式(3)——抽象工厂模式
  17. 题目--oil Deposits(油田) 基础DFS(深度搜索)
  18. Spark 集成开发
  19. 006.Docker网络管理
  20. Confluence 6 指派空间权限概念

热门文章

  1. MySQL出现Waiting for table metadata lock的原因以及解决方法(转)
  2. C# winform打开新窗体显示一段时间 关闭新窗体
  3. Java学习——日期类
  4. Java生鲜电商平台-积分,优惠券,会员折扣,签到、预售、拼团、砍价、秒杀及抽奖等促销模块架构设计
  5. vue如何导入外部js文件(es6)
  6. Android RadioButton控件
  7. github 分支管理
  8. linux epoll,poll,select
  9. 004-OpenStack-计算服务
  10. JVM 对象查询语言(OQL)[转载]